WebEven on hot spring days, lakes, ponds, and rivers are still cold and are dangerous for swimmers. Hypothermia can occur quickly in very cold water. Summer – Water that is warm on the surface, may be much colder below. Use caution when swimming and always supervise young children playing in or near the water.

WebSwimming in the ocean is not the same as swimming in a pool or lake. Wind, waves, the change of the tide, the slope of the beach and other factors can cause strong currents to be present in the water even on the calmest days. ... Where beach flags are in operation, observe these at all times – they are there to ensure safety and ultimately save lives! You should not swim in the sea if a red flag is flying as this indicates dangerous conditions.
